Understanding Anxiety: A Modern Challenge
Anxiety disorders manifest in various forms, including generalized anxiety disorder, social anxiety, panic attacks, and phobias. The current climate, exacerbated by economic uncertainty and the repercussions of the COVID-19 pandemic, puts many at risk for heightened anxiety symptoms. Mental health awareness has gained traction, fostering discussions about the urgency of addressing mental health policies and providing easier healthcare access.

Practical Coping Strategies for Anxiety Relief
Incorporating mindfulness into your daily routine can open doors to effective anxiety management. Techniques such as relaxation exercises, breathing techniques, and physical activities like yoga can significantly reduce anxiety symptoms. Engaging with support groups and exploring resources like self-help books can also empower individuals on their journeys toward mental wellness.
